Conditions

Primary osteoporosis

Interventions

Control group:Standard Western medicine treatment for primary osteoporosis
Experimental group:''Bushen Qianggu decoction'' combined with standard protocol of Western medicine treatment for primary osteoporosis

Eligibility

Sex/Gender
All
Age
50 Years to 80 Years

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Dual-energy X-ray bone mineral density examination: minimum bone mineral density T-value of lumbar spine, femoral neck or total hip <=2.5. 2. Any one of the symptoms in the TCM symptom grading scale of osteoporosis is present and the score is moderate or above. 3. TCM syndrome differentiation is ''deficiency of kidney Yang syndrome''. 4. Aged 50-80 years. 5. Sign the informed consent form.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ients with secondary osteoporosis (unstable primary disease). 2. Patients with mental diseases or cognitive dysfunction. 3. Received anti-osteoporosis drug therapy within 3 years of study inclusion for at least 6 months. 4. Patients with allergies or contraindications to the drugs used in the study. 5. Significantly abnormal liver and kidney function (indication: AST or ALT>=2.5 times the upper limit of normal, eGFR<=60ml/min.1.73m^2). 6. History of tumors, heart, brain, kidney and other serious organ diseases (except thyroid and early breast cancer). 7. The patient's symptoms, such as low back pain, are caused by causes other than osteoporosis. 8. The researcher believes that the patient is not suitable to participate in this study.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Assessment of improvement in quality of life ;Bone metabolism biomarkers;Evaluation of clinical efficacy according to ''Clinical Guiding Principles of New Chinese traditional Medicine'';Liver and kidney function;Urological ultrasound (Whether there are stones or not);
